Indonesian humor is highly unique, often categorized as receh (low-effort or silly humor) and slapstick. Creators use regional dialects (like Javanese or Sundanese) and relatable everyday struggles—such as dealing with traffic, street food culture, or strict parents—to create hyper-viral skits. To understand where Indonesian popular videos are going, we first need to look at where they came from. For nearly three decades, the landscape was dominated by free-to-air television. Channels like RCTI, SCTV, and Indosiar were the gatekeepers of culture.

TikTok remains the undisputed kingmaker of the Indonesian music industry. A song's success is now heavily reliant on its "virality"—its ability to be used as a soundtrack for thousands of short video creations. Tracks like "Kota Ini Tak Sama Tanpamu" and "Ada Titik-Titik di Ujung Doa" are prime examples of this phenomenon, transitioning from TikTok trends to Spotify chart-toppers in a seamless feedback loop. This has led musicians to strategically write songs with catchy, 1-minute hooks designed for immediate virality.
